Im probably gonna stick with using steam for gyro aim + flickstick controls they're just way more precise than what a stick can do alone but in all honesty quite a bit worse than a mouse, also to not have to use claw I'll probably just swap one bumper button to jump and use x for whatever the bumper had. Because in my eyes the only benefit with claw over normal is being able to jump easily while aiming, like using your thumb stick press to jump while aiming kinda sucks because lifetime of the thumbsticks degrades and if you use another for crouch you're probably gonna use the one for aiming which makes your aim wobble every time you jump. Definetly don't need to use gyro for the good old bumper swap either. Only game i can think of it not working at the moment is fortnite with building but I dont play that anymore anyway and also theres now a zero build mode. Also claw is kinda useless for a lot of 2d platformery games like hollow knight, rainworld and celeste where the other thumbstick is entirely useless! Also a fun thing with gyro is that it shouldn't be limited to steam games as you can add any game you want to be launched via steam with steam overlay and the controller options to play kbm games with a controller too. As someone who is fortunate enough to also own an Xbox Series S and PS5, I find the Xbox Series controller more comfortable. I play claw and if theres a time that I’m not pressing A,B,X or Y, I simply rest my finger ( index ) on the diagonal with the tip of my finger pointing at the right stick. So the tip sits on the A button. If I am pressing something, naturally where the buttons are so much closer together ( as opposed to the PS controllers ) I found I can simply use the side of my finger ( again the index ) to press the B button while keeping the tip of it on top of the A button. And I basically do the same also for pressing either X or Y. If ya’ll are still using the Xbox ONE controller, that’s still great, but if u didn’t know the Series controllers are around 20% smaller so if u find you’re having to stretch a lot, then a Series Controller may be the move.
